I have Tein Flex w/EDFC but unfortunately my car is in the shop until next Saturday. If you could wait until then, I wouldn't mind. I also had Tanabe DF210's and got ride of them because they were too low. Depending on what setting you have them on, the Tein Flex range from pretty comparable to a lot stiffer. I love my coils though. I will never do just springs again. The difference between springs and coils is like night and day.
